Activating the Send Notification Component
To activate the Send Notification component:
-
Select the component for which you created the template.
You must have previously created a component template and associated it with a component. Navigate to that component page on your browser. You should see a Notify button in the lower part of the screen.
-
Click the Notify button.
This action saves the transaction and opens the Send Notification component. The text from the template appears on this page and shows that all of the variables have been resolved.
Note:
BlackBerry responses do not appear in the template text section.
-
Enter the names or email addresses of the recipients in the To, CC, or BCC fields.
-
Enter the message text in the Message Text field.
-
Click the Send button.
Additional Notes about Send Notification
Activating the Send Notification component validates recipient names (not email addresses) and then determines whether any BlackBerry email responses must be appended to the message text.
If the template includes BlackBerry email responses, a globally unique identifier (GUID) is generated and linked to the NOTIFY_ID. The GUID is appended to the subject text so that it is available in the reply email message. The system sorts the users by preferred language and sends the notifications by language to the recipients.
The send method in the notification application class determines whether the send is Worklist, Email, or Both (based on the values that the recipient sets in the workflow routing preferences user profile).
All notifications are saved to the database and keyed by NOTIFY_ID and LANG_CD.
